Yorkie Poos: How big do Yorkie Poos grow
Prospective pet parents often wonder, “How big do Yorkie-poos get?” Once again, their lineage determines a lot. The average Yorkie-poo size is 7–15 inches tall at the shoulder and 5–15 pounds A Yorkie-poo adult with a
toy poodle parent
is tinier than one with a miniature poodle parent.
Yorkie Poo Hypoallergenic: Is a Yorkie Poo hypoallergenic
Yorkipoo are considered hypoallergenic dogs for the most part , although there’s no guarantee they won’t aggravate your allergies. The Kennel Club in the UK suggest the Poodle and the Yorkie as hypoallergenic breeds.
Life Expectancy: What is the life expectancy of a Yorkie Poo
Health & Lifespan: How Long do Yorkie Poos Live? This small, energetic breed has a long lifespan that only increases with excellent care. While the average Yorkie Poo lives between 10 and 15 years , vets agree that even that 15 isn’t necessarily a limit.

Yorkie Poos: Do Yorkie Poos have hair or fur
Since Yorkiepoos generally have a combination of Yorkie and Poodle hair traits , their hair can be a variety of textures. Yorkie hair tends to be a similar texture to human hair, can grow very long, and can tangle if it’s not cared for properly. Poodle hair, on the other hand, tends to be thick and curly.
Oldest Yorkie Poo: What’s the oldest Yorkie Poo
How Old Is The Oldest Yorkie Poo? Many Yorkie poos live to be about 15 years old and in some cases even longer than that! In 2011, A Yorkie called Bonny lived to 28, beating the previous record of 22 years of age set by a Yorkie called Lucy, in Holland.
